Verkhnyaya Pyshma ( _ru. Ве́рхняя Пышма́) is a town in
Sverdlovsk Oblast ,Russia , situated km to mi|10 kilometers north ofYekaterinburg . Population: ru-census|p2002=58016|p1989=53102Postal code : 624080. International dialing code: +7 (34368). Mayor:Yuri Yakovlev .History
It was founded in 1660 as the village ("selo" of Pyshminskoye (named after the
Pyshma River ). Acopper mine opened here in 1856. Town status was granted to it in 1946.Ecology and health issues
In late July 2007, the town was hit by an outburst of atypical pneumonia, with 165 infected and 5 death cases. According to official information, the infection was caused by
Legionella pneumophila virus, spread through thewater supply network . However, there was much speculation that biological warfare (similarly toSverdlovsk anthrax leak in 1979), or the pollution from chemical industry, is responsible for the infection.Fact|date=December 2007.Also serious ecological issues due to severe environment pollution Fact|date=December 2007.
Coat of arms
The coat of arms of the town is a gryphon holding gold "mirror of Venus".The gryphon is the guard of riches and also the symbol of strength of mind.The "mirror of Venus" is the sign of copper, which is being mined in the region.

Uralelectromed " began production in 1934. It is now part of the "Urals Mining and Metal Company". "Uralelectromed" is one of the key Russian enterprises in the non-ferrous metallurgy. Main types of products include copper cathodes, copper powder, copper sulfate, wire rods, as well as gold and silver ingots.Joint-stock company "
Uralredmet " (formerly "Pyshminsky Experimental Plant") is located in Verkhnyaya Pyshma. The plant was commissioned in 1958. Products:
*high purity rare and rare-earth metals, their oxides and fluorides;
*refractory metals and their oxides;
*phosphors;Key activities of the company:
*manufacture of vanadium based master alloys by the aluminothermic reduction method for titanium alloys;
*manufacture of high purity (99.9%) vanadium ingots by the electron beam melting method;
*manufacture of electrolytic vanadium powder (purity 99.7%);
*manufacture of rare-earth oxides by the liquid-liquid extraction method;
*manufacture of red color glow phosphors on the basis of yttrium oxysulphide, activated by europium and pigmented by iron oxide, for color cathode-rat tubes;
*manufacture of phosphors for high-pressure mercury arc lamps on the basis of yttrium phosphate-borate-vanadate, activated by europium and terbium;The company supplies its products to customers in nuclear, electronic and aircraft industries as well as to a number of academic and industrial scientific institutes.Products with the
Uralredmet brand is renowned for its high quality both inRussia and abroad. The company is included in the official supplier list ofGeneral Electric (United States ).References
